一、系统架构与核心技术选型
1.1 ESB总线架构的分布式设计
企业服务总线(ESB)作为系统核心架构,通过标准化消息路由机制实现异构系统间的解耦。采用XML/JSON格式的消息封装协议,支持HTTP/REST/SOAP等多种传输协议,确保与主流ERP、CRM系统的无缝对接。总线内置服务编排引擎,可动态组合微服务形成业务流,例如将订单处理拆解为库存校验、支付网关调用、物流接口触发等原子操作。
1.2 混合云部署架构
系统支持私有化部署与公有云混合架构,核心业务数据存储在本地Oracle数据库,非敏感数据通过消息队列同步至云端对象存储。这种设计既满足零售企业对数据主权的严格要求,又利用云服务的弹性扩展能力应对促销季流量高峰。典型部署方案采用3节点Oracle RAC集群保障高可用,配合分布式缓存提升系统响应速度。
二、核心功能模块解析
2.1 全渠道零售管理
分销管理模块实现线上线下库存实时同步,通过API网关对接主流电商平台,自动处理不同渠道的订单归集与拆分。零售POS系统支持断网销售模式,本地数据库缓存交易数据,网络恢复后自动完成数据同步。VIP管理模块集成RFID技术,实现会员到店自动识别与个性化推荐。
2.2 智能财务核算体系
财务模块内置多会计准则适配引擎,可同时生成符合GAAP与IFRS标准的财务报表。通过RPA机器人自动处理银行对账、发票核验等重复性工作,将月末结账周期从72小时缩短至8小时。系统预置的税务合规引擎实时更新各地税法变化,自动生成申报数据包。
2.3 多维数据分析平台
内置的Cub分析工具采用列式存储与向量化计算技术,支持TB级数据的秒级响应。提供预置的零售行业分析模型,包括销售趋势预测、库存周转优化、会员生命周期价值计算等。数据可视化模块支持拖拽式仪表盘配置,业务人员可自主创建看板而无需依赖IT部门。
三、低代码开发平台实现
3.1 可视化开发环境
开发平台提供表单设计器、流程建模工具及API连接器三大核心组件。表单设计器采用JSON Schema驱动,支持复杂业务逻辑的条件跳转与数据校验。流程引擎内置BPMN 2.0标准符号库,可实现多级审批、异常处理等复杂流程编排。
3.2 第三方系统集成方案
通过标准化适配器框架,系统可快速对接电子发票、电子签章、物流追踪等外部服务。集成开发过程分为三步:首先在适配器市场选择预置连接器,其次配置认证参数与字段映射关系,最后通过模拟测试验证集成效果。典型案例显示,新增一个支付渠道的集成时间从2周缩短至2天。
3.3 安全开发实践
系统采用多层安全防护机制:传输层启用TLS 1.3加密,应用层实施基于JWT的令牌认证,数据层采用AES-256加密存储。开发平台内置安全扫描工具,可自动检测SQL注入、XSS攻击等常见漏洞。代码生成器遵循最小权限原则,确保每个微服务仅拥有必要的数据访问权限。
四、行业应用与价值验证
4.1 特许经营司法取证
ESB总线的消息审计功能完整记录所有系统交互,每条消息包含时间戳、操作类型、数据变更等元信息。在某连锁品牌纠纷案中,系统提供的完整数据链成功证明加盟商违规操作,成为关键司法证据。审计日志采用区块链技术存证,确保数据不可篡改。
4.2 快速部署实施方法论
Cloud版本采用容器化部署方案,通过Kubernetes集群实现资源弹性伸缩。实施团队总结出”7-3-1”部署法:7天完成基础环境搭建,3天进行业务系统配置,1天完成压力测试与上线切换。某服装品牌实施案例显示,系统上线首月即实现库存周转率提升18%,人工成本降低12%。
4.3 持续迭代机制
系统采用微服务架构设计,每个功能模块独立部署与升级。通过灰度发布策略,新功能可先在部分门店试点运行,收集反馈后再全面推广。版本控制采用GitFlow工作流,确保开发、测试、生产环境代码一致性。每月发布功能更新包,每季度进行重大版本升级。
结语:在零售行业数字化转型浪潮中,基于ESB架构的业务管理系统展现出强大的适应性。通过模块化设计、低代码开发及智能分析能力的有机结合,该方案有效解决了企业面临的系统孤岛、响应滞后等核心痛点。随着AI技术的深入应用,下一代系统将集成智能预测、自动化决策等能力,推动零售运营模式向认知型商业进化。